The linear bearings market has emerged as a significant segment in the broader industrial components sector. Linear bearings, which enable smooth linear motion along a fixed path, are widely used in machinery, automation equipment, robotics, and precision instruments. Their importance stems from their ability to reduce friction, improve motion efficiency, and extend the lifespan of equipment. Industries that rely on precise motion control, such as automotive, electronics, aerospace, and medical devices, have increasingly adopted linear bearings to enhance performance and reliability.

Key Applications
Linear bearings find extensive use in industries that require precise movement along straight paths. In the automotive sector, they are applied in assembly lines and robotics to improve production speed and accuracy. In electronics manufacturing, linear bearings are used in pick-and-place machines and inspection equipment to ensure flawless handling of delicate components. The aerospace sector relies on linear bearings in flight simulators and control mechanisms, while medical equipment such as MRI machines and surgical robots benefit from their precision and reliability.
Technological Advancements
The market has been influenced by continuous technological improvements. New materials, such as ceramics and advanced polymers, have enhanced bearing performance by reducing weight and increasing corrosion resistance. Additionally, the integration of sensors with linear bearings allows real-time monitoring of wear and operational efficiency, which contributes to predictive maintenance strategies. These technological advancements have made linear bearings more versatile and adaptable to complex industrial needs.

Regional Insights
The linear bearings market is expanding across North America, Europe, Asia-Pacific, and other regions. Asia-Pacific, driven by manufacturing hubs in China, Japan, and India, represents a significant portion of the market due to the concentration of industrial and electronics production. North America and Europe are also witnessing steady growth, particularly in high-precision industries and automation-driven manufacturing sectors.
